CrawlJobs Logo

Software Engineer Mobile Android/iOS

360learning.com Logo

360Learning

Location Icon

Location:
France , Paris

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

Not provided

Job Description:

We are a team of 9 mobile software engineers, 1 Engineering Manager, and 1 Project Manager working on a best-in-class mobile solution that includes two native mobile applications powered by a modern tech stack (Kotlin Multiplatform, Jetpack Compose, SwiftUI), extensive CI setup (Bitrise), custom apps, internal DX tools, and so on. As part of the R&D department with more than 80 engineers, our mobile team is imperative to 360learning’s response to our increasingly demanding customers for an engaging learning experience on mobile.

Job Responsibility:

  • Lead real and complex technical challenges
  • Work on an attractive technical stack
  • Within an R&D team that allows rapid progress
  • Within 1 month: Discover the 360Learning platform, Have a global view of our codebase, Get used to the team's processes, Implement your first tickets, Integrate our decentralized peer review process
  • Within 3 months: Work on the development of broader functionalities, Gain skills on our stack
  • Within 6 months: Share your best practices within the team, Create your own courses on the 360Learning platform, Implement cross-functional tools, Document, refactor, and analyze features
  • Within 9-12 months: Onboard the new engineers of the team, Work on complex functionalities that impact several teams and stakeholders, Work on architectural changes impacting our entire code base

Requirements:

  • First experience in native Android development
  • Interested, ready to learn, and develop for Kotlin Multiplatform and iOS
  • Like learning new technologies and applying them in practice
  • Comfortable with algorithms
  • Fluent in English (level B2 or equivalent)
  • Show enthusiasm for our culture
What we offer:
  • Work From Home stipend
  • RTT
  • lunch vouchers
  • medical insurance
  • gym subscription
  • 1 month parental leave for the second parent
  • Flexible hours
  • full remote work possible anywhere in France
  • Diversity, Equity, and Inclusion: We have 6 active ERGs including Mental Health, Environmental/Sustainability, Women, Parents, LGBTQIA2S+, and Ethnic Diversity
  • Corporate Social Responsibility

Additional Information:

Job Posted:
January 03, 2026

Employment Type:
Fulltime
Work Type:
Remote work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Software Engineer Mobile Android/iOS

Sr. Technical Project Manager

We are seeking a Sr. Technical Project Manager to lead and coordinate product ch...
Location
Location
United States , Costa Mesa
Salary
Salary:
103170.00 - 158873.00 USD / Year
haeaus.com Logo
Hyundai AutoEver America
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in computer science, Software Engineering, Information Systems, or a closely related technical discipline
  • 10+ years of combined experience in software project management and technical systems implementation
  • Strong familiarity with connected vehicle platforms, mobile applications, and cloud-based backend services
  • Technical knowledge in: API architecture and tools: Understanding of REST/GraphQL APIs, with hands-on experience using Postman, Swagger, and basic API management and testing tools
  • Mobile app development (Android/iOS): Familiar with the full development lifecycle, compliance for app store releases, and common frameworks like Kotlin, Swift, or React Native
  • Middleware and integrations: Experience with API interfaces using ESB and basic integration patterns for connecting systems and services
  • Databases: Knowledge of both SQL (e.g., MySQL, PostgreSQL) and NoSQL (e.g., MongoDB) databases, including how to write queries and manage data
  • Cloud platforms: Basic experience working with cloud services like AWS, Azure, or Google Cloud for hosting, storage, and serverless functions
  • Hands-on experience with development testing, system analysis, and platform monitoring
  • Advanced proficiency in JIRA, Confluence, MS Project, or equivalent PM and documentation tools
Job Responsibility
Job Responsibility
  • Own the end-to-end lifecycle of change requests, including technical assessment, scope definition, impact analysis, and solution feasibility
  • Coordinate innovative initiatives with development teams to evaluate new technologies or solution architectures
  • Collaborate with solution architects and developers to understand and validate technical feasibility of feature enhancements and system changes
  • Maintain a robust change prioritization framework that balances technical complexity, platform impact, and business value across multiple stakeholders
  • Lead development of detailed, technically sound project execution plans, with emphasis on system integrations, interface compatibility, and deployment dependencies
  • Support backend API review sessions, API testing coordination, and validation of interface agreements between mobile apps, middleware, and vehicle head units
  • Actively participate in design and architecture discussions to ensure alignment with platform principles
  • Coordinate development testing, UAT preparation, and cross-platform regression testing for each change deployment
  • Work with system analysts to validate business and technical requirements for connected vehicle features, mobile app behavior, and cloud service integrations
  • Support documentation of technical workflows, data exchanges, and API specs for integration with third-party vendors and internal systems
  • Fulltime
Read More
Arrow Right

Software Engineer

Design, Architect and Develop various Mobile software applications for Android o...
Location
Location
United States , Alpharetta
Salary
Salary:
Not provided
nebulapartners.com Logo
Nebula Partners
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Master's degree in Computers/ IT/IS/ Business / Engineering (Any) or closely related field with 6 months of experience in the job offered or as an IT Consultant or Analyst or Developer or Programmer or closely related fields
  • Bachelor's degree in Computers/ IT/IS/ Business / Engineering (Any) or closely related field plus 5 years of progressive work experience in related field
  • Six (6) Months of Developing Android or IOS Apps and Mobile Development Using Objective-C Language or Java
  • Travel And/or relocation to Unanticipated Client Sites Throughout USA is required
Job Responsibility
Job Responsibility
  • Design, Architect and Develop various Mobile software applications for Android or iOS based mobile platforms
  • Develop graphics intensive real-time rendered application for Android/iOS operating systems in Java or Objective-C
  • Deploy the app on the Android Marketplace or Apple Store and support the app for different releases of operating system upgrades
  • Research and suggest new mobile products, applications and protocols and stay up-to-date with new technology trend in mobile software application development
  • Work under supervision
  • Travel And/or Relocation to unanticipated client sites is required
What we offer
What we offer
  • Standard Company Benefits
  • Fulltime
Read More
Arrow Right

Software Engineer

Design, Architect and Develop various Mobile software applications for Android o...
Location
Location
United States , Alpharetta
Salary
Salary:
Not provided
nebulapartners.com Logo
Nebula Partners
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Masters degree in Computers/ IT/ IS/ Business / Engineering (Any) or closely related field with 6 months of experience in the job offered or as a IT Consultant or Analyst or Developer or Programmer or very closely related area
  • Bachelors degree in Computers/ IT/ IS/Business/Engineering (Any) or related field plus 5 years of progressive work experience in related field
  • 6 months of developing software applications with C# or Java programming language
  • Experience with Database development on enterprise level database servers such as SQL server or Oracle database server or MYSQL server
Job Responsibility
Job Responsibility
  • Design, Architect and Develop various Mobile software applications for Android or iOS-based mobile platforms
  • Develop graphics-intensive real-time rendered application for Android/iOS operating systems in Java or Objective-C
  • Deploy the app on the Android Marketplace or Apple Store and support the app for different releases of operating system upgrades
  • Research and suggest new mobile products, applications and protocols and stay up-to-date with new technology trends in mobile software application development
  • Travel And/Or Relocation to unanticipated client sites is required
What we offer
What we offer
  • Standard Company Benefits
  • Fulltime
Read More
Arrow Right

Software Engineer

Design, Architect and Develop various Mobile software applications for Android o...
Location
Location
United States , Alpharetta
Salary
Salary:
Not provided
nebulapartners.com Logo
Nebula Partners
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Master's degree in Computers/IT/IS/Business/Engineering (Any) or closely Related field with 6 months of experience in the job offered or as a IT Consultant or IT Analyst or Developer or Programmer or IT Engineer or very closely related area
  • OR Bachelor's degree in Computers/IT/IS/Business/Engineering (Any) or Closely related field plus 5 years of progressive work experience in related field
  • 6 months of Developing Android or IOS Apps and Mobile Development using OBJECTIVE-C language or Java
  • Travel And/Or relocation to unanticipated client sites is required
Job Responsibility
Job Responsibility
  • Design, Architect and Develop various Mobile software applications for Android or iOS based mobile platforms
  • Develop graphics intensive real-time rendered application for Android/iOS operating systems in Java or Objective-C
  • Deploy the app on the Android Marketplace or Apple Store and support the app for different releases of operating system upgrades
  • Research and suggest new mobile products, applications and protocols and stay up to date with new technology trend in mobile software application development
  • Work under supervision
  • Travel And/Or Relocation to unanticipated client sites is required
What we offer
What we offer
  • Standard Company Benefits
  • Fulltime
Read More
Arrow Right

Senior Automation Developer

Location
Location
United States , San Diego
Salary
Salary:
Not provided
tateeda.com Logo
Tateeda GLOBAL
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S/MS degree in Computer Science, Engineering or a related subject
  • 5+ years experience in software quality assurance
  • automation experience is a must
  • Professional experience with JavaScript/Typescript
  • Professional experience with Cypress and Appium
  • Professional experience with Mobile Testing (on all platforms, Android/iOS)
  • Solid knowledge of SQL and scripting
  • Experience in writing clear, concise and comprehensive test plans and test cases
  • Hands-on experience with both white box and black box testing
  • Experience working in an Agile/Scrum development process
Job Responsibility
Job Responsibility
  • Review quality specifications and technical design documents to provide timely and meaningful feedback
  • Create detailed, comprehensive and well-structured test plans and test cases
  • Estimate, prioritize, plan and coordinate quality testing activities
  • Maintain and apply strong understanding of business practices to effectively fulfill responsibilities while working on multiple high-priority tasks
  • Design, develop and implement scenario testing for existing code base and for new functionality under development, using a strong understanding of security-based design patterns
  • Identify, record, document thoroughly and track bugs
  • Perform thorough regression testing when bugs are resolved
  • Participate in scrum agile development process
What we offer
What we offer
  • Interesting projects and challenging tasks
  • Professional and personal growth
  • 5-day workweek in a friendly and family work environment
  • Competitive salary
  • Flexible full-time work
  • Ability to work remotely
  • English training
  • Active team building and corporate parties
  • Fulltime
Read More
Arrow Right
New

Vice President - React Native Engineering Lead

Join us as a Vice President - React Native Engineering Lead at Barclays, where y...
Location
Location
India , Pune
Salary
Salary:
Not provided
barclays.co.uk Logo
Barclays
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• UI technologies like React 18, React Native 0.73
  • Angular
  • Full stack Java - hands on experience
  • TypeScript/JavaScript, Redux
  • Microservices and Springboot
  • Application servers (Tomcat)
  • AWS Cloud Technologies/Azure/GCP
  • Designing modular engineering
  • Events and Messaging
  • Secure storage/token handling and onboarding customers in bank digital
Job Responsibility
Job Responsibility
  • Build responsive, accessible React Native components and screens with TypeScript/JavaScript, Redux state management and robust navigation patterns
  • Integrate secure authentication flows (OAuth2/JWT, biometrics SDKs) and partner SDKs
  • handle secure storage and token lifecycles
  • Consume RESTful APIs
  • collaborate closely with backend (Java/Spring Boot) on contract-first designs and error handling
  • Optimize performance (lazy loading, code splitting, profiling) and ensure crash free stability across Android/iOS
  • Uphold OWASP secure coding principles, accessibility and observability practices
  • Participate in code reviews, unit/UI testing, sprint ceremonies and release activities
  • Development and delivery of high-quality software solutions by using industry aligned programming languages, frameworks, and tools
  • Ensuring that code is scalable, maintainable, and optimized for performance
What we offer
What we offer
  • Competitive holiday allowance
  • Life assurance
  • Private medical care
  • Pension contribution
  • Fulltime
Read More
Arrow Right

React Native Tech Lead

Join us as a React Native Tech Lead at Barclays, where you will be responsible f...
Location
Location
India , Pune
Salary
Salary:
Not provided
barclays.co.uk Logo
Barclays
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Build responsive, accessible React Native components and screens with TypeScript/JavaScript, Redux state management and robust navigation patterns
  • Integrate secure authentication flows (OAuth2/JWT, biometrics SDKs) and partner SDKs
  • handle secure storage and token lifecycles
  • Consume RESTful APIs
  • collaborate closely with backend (Java/Spring Boot) on contract-first designs and error handling
  • Optimize performance (lazy loading, code splitting, profiling) and ensure crash free stability across Android/iOS
  • Uphold OWASP secure coding principles, accessibility and observability practices
  • Participate in code reviews, unit/UI testing, sprint ceremonies and release activities
  • Must Have Skills - React Native, React 18, TypeScript/JavaScript, Redux
  • mobile UI/UX
Job Responsibility
Job Responsibility
  • Support the successful delivery of location strategy projects to plan, budget, agreed quality and governance standards
  • Spearhead the evolution of our digital landscape, driving innovation and excellence
  • Harness cutting-edge technology to revolutionise our digital offerings, ensuring unparalleled customer experiences
  • Design and develop customer-facing mobile features using React Native with strong focus on security, performance and reliability
  • Collaborate with Java/API teams and SDETs to ship high quality increments in agile sprints
  • Development and delivery of high-quality software solutions by using industry aligned programming languages, frameworks, and tools
  • Ensuring that code is scalable, maintainable, and optimized for performance
  •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ies, and ensure seamless integration and alignment with business objectives
  • Collaboration with peers, participate in code reviews, and promote a culture of code quality and knowledge sharing
  • Stay informed of industry technology trends and innovations and actively contribute to the organization’s technology communities to foster a culture of technical excellence and growth
What we offer
What we offer
  • Competitive holiday allowance
  • Life assurance
  • Private medical care
  • Pension contribution
  • Fulltime
Read More
Arrow Right

React Native Developer

Join us as a React Native Developer at Barclays, where you will be responsible f...
Location
Location
India , Pune
Salary
Salary:
Not provided
barclays.co.uk Logo
Barclays
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Build responsive, accessible React Native components and screens with TypeScript/JavaScript, Redux state management and robust navigation patterns
  • Integrate secure authentication flows (OAuth2/JWT, biometrics SDKs) and partner SDKs
  • handle secure storage and token lifecycles
  • Consume RESTful APIs
  • collaborate closely with backend (Java/Spring Boot) on contract-first designs and error handling
  • Optimize performance (lazy loading, code splitting, profiling) and ensure crashfree stability across Android/iOS
  • Uphold OWASP secure coding principles, accessibility and observability practices
  • Participate in code reviews, unit/UI testing, sprint ceremonies and release activities
  • Must Have Skills - React Native, React 18, TypeScript/JavaScript, Redux
  • mobile UI/UX
Job Responsibility
Job Responsibility
  • Support the successful delivery of location strategy projects to plan, budget, agreed quality and governance standards
  • Spearhead the evolution of our digital landscape, driving innovation and excellence
  • Harness cutting-edge technology to revolutionise our digital offerings, ensuring unparalleled customer experiences
  • Design and develop customer-facing mobile features using React Native with strong focus on security, performance and reliability
  • Collaborate with Java/API teams and SDETs to ship high quality increments in agile sprints
  • Development and delivery of high-quality software solutions by using industry aligned programming languages, frameworks, and tools
  • Ensuring that code is scalable, maintainable, and optimized for performance
  •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ies, and ensure seamless integration and alignment with business objectives
  • Collaboration with peers, participate in code reviews, and promote a culture of code quality and knowledge sharing
  • Stay informed of industry technology trends and innovations and actively contribute to the organization’s technology communities to foster a culture of technical excellence and growth
What we offer
What we offer
  • Competitive holiday allowance
  • Life assurance
  • Private medical care
  • Pension contribution
  • Fulltime
Read More
Arrow Right